Women’s Basketball Earns Two Wins at Palm Beach Tournament

Friday Afternoon in Lake Worth, Indian River State College hosted Nationally Ranked Illinois Central. The Pioneers jumped out to a 22 – 3 lead and never looked back. Indian River defeated Illinois Central 75 – 64, three Pioneers was in double Digits Jasmine Peaks added 18 points, seven rebounds and five assists. Rapuluchi Ngorka tallied another double double scoring 17 point and a season high 21 rebounds. Sophomore Guard Tavi Habib added 11 points, five rebounds, five assist and three steals.

"At the start of the game, we jumped out to an 18 – 0 led. We were clicking on all cylinders, in the second half went away from defending at a high level which cause us to struggle. Overall, I am happy we pulled out the win, we are still working on playing 40 minutes consistently."

In the second Matchup Indian River defeated Florida State of Jacksonville 82 – 63, the Pioneers took the led in the first quarter and never looked back. Rapuluchi Ngorka scored 20 points and 12 rebounds, Sophomore Tavi Habib scored 12 points and seven rebounds and Makala Torrence tallied 12 points.

With the win The River is 4 – 0 on the season, next matchup is Tuesday November 22nd against Saint Petersburg.
